﻿html {
	overflow-y:scroll;
}
body {
	background: #FFF;
	padding: 0;
	margin: 0;
	width:960px;
	margin:10px auto 0
}

#main{
	width: 960px;
	float:left;
	padding-bottom: 0px;
}
#main img{
border:0;
}

#main h1{
display:none;
}
#main h2{
display:none;
}

#main1{
	margin: 0;
	padding: 0;
	color: #FFF;
	width: 960px;
	height: 380px;
	font-family: "ＭＳ 明朝", "Osaka－等幅";
	float: left;
	}


div#top div#nav {
float : left;
clear : both;
width : 960px;
height : 52px;
margin :0;
}



div#header {
margin : 0;
}


div#slider div#slide-holder {
z-index : 40;
width : 960px;
height : 380px;
position : absolute;
}
div#slider div#slide-holder div#slide-runner {
top : 0px;
left : 0px;
width : 960px;
height : 380px;
overflow : hidden;
position : absolute;
}
div#slider div#slide-holder img {
margin : 0;
display : none;
position : absolute;
}
div#slider div#slide-holder div#slide-controls {
left : 0;
bottom : -10px;
width : 960px;
height : 46px;
display : none;
position : absolute;
}

div#slider div#slide-holder div#slide-controls p#slide-nav {
float : right;
height : 24px;
display : inline;
margin : 5px 20px 0 0;
}
div#slider div#slide-holder div#slide-controls p#slide-nav a {
float : left;
width : 24px;
height : 24px;
color : #BBB;
display : inline;
font-size : 11px;
margin : 0 4px 0 0;
line-height : 24px;
font-weight : bold;
text-align : center;
text-decoration : none;
background-position : 0 0;
background-repeat : no-repeat;
}
div#slider div#slide-holder div#slide-controls p#slide-nav a.on {
background-position : 0 -24px;
}
div#slider div#slide-holder div#slide-controls p#slide-nav a {
background-image : url(./js/slide-nav.png);
}







#main1 img{
border:0;
}

#main2{
	margin:0;
	padding: 0;
	color: #FFF;
	font-family: "ＭＳ 明朝", "Osaka－等幅";
	width: 640px;
	height: 320px;
	float:left;
}

#main2 img{
border:0;
}

#video{
	margin:0;
	padding: 0;
	color: #FFF;
	font-family: "ＭＳ 明朝", "Osaka－等幅";
	width: 320px;
	height: 320px;
	float:left;
}

#news{
	width: 630px;
	height: 280px;
	margin-left: 0px;
	margin-bottom: 0px;
	overflow:auto;
	float:left;
	background-color: #EEE;
	font-weight: normal;
	margin-top: 0px;
	color: #FF0000;
	font-family: "メイリオ", Meiryo, Osaka, "ＭＳ Ｐゴシック", "MS PGothic", sans-serif;
	font-size:12px;
	line-height:normal;
	text-align: left;
	padding-left: 10px;

}

#sub{
	width: 320px;
	float:left;
	height: 240px;
}
#sub a{
border:0;
}



#news1{
		font-size:10px;
}

#subbt{
	margin-top: 10px;
	width:300px;
	padding-left:10px;
	float: left;
	margin-left: 0px;
}

#counter {
	margin-left:275px;
	float: left;
	width: 40px;
	text-align: left;
	margin-top: 10px;
}


#footer{
	float: left;
	margin-top: 0px;
	clear:both;
	width:960px;
	background:  url(titlelogo2_20pix.jpg) top left no-repeat;
	text-align:justify;
	color: #FFFFFF;

  }

#footercorp{
	margin-top: 0px;
	clear:both;
	width:960px;
	text-align:right;
	color: #FFFFFF;
	position: relative;
	top: 0em;
	}

